调研报告:Three.js 音乐播放器(炫酷歌词效果)
调研时间:2026-04-21 | 数据源:Reddit + Twitter
1. 市场信号
核心结论:没有找到任何"用户希望音乐播放器有更炫酷歌词效果"的痛点信号
在 12 轮搜索(第一轮 6 轮 + 第二轮 6 轮)中,覆盖了以下关键词:
- Reddit: "music player visualizer", "music visualizer app", "music visualizer paying", "music player beautiful UI lyrics", "spotify lyrics visual effect"
- Twitter: "music player visualizer cool", "3D music visualizer three.js", "music visualizer app paying", "music player lyrics animation", "wish music player had visual"
结果:零条用户抱怨音乐播放器歌词/视觉效果不够好的帖子或推文。
发现的相关内容(按互动量排序)
内容 1:Easy Lyric Motion System — 歌词动画工具(801 likes, 858 bookmarks)
- 内容描述:@mollowmollow 开发的 JavaScript 歌词动画自动控制系统,为 VJ 和内容创作者提供歌词动态效果
- 互动证据:801 likes, 858 bookmarks — 高互动但面向内容创作者,不是音乐播放器用户
- 用户原话:
"Easy Lyric Motion System — a JavaScript tool that automatically controls lyric animation timing and effects. Designed for VJs and content creators." — @mollowmollow (801 likes, 858 bookmarks) 中文:Easy 歌词运动系统 — 一个自动控制歌词动画时间和效果的 JavaScript 工具,专为 VJ 和内容创作者设计
- 与假设的关系:这个工具面向的是制作歌词视频/现场演出视觉的内容创作者,不是日常听歌的用户。说明歌词动画有市场,但在内容创作工具赛道,不在音乐播放器赛道。
内容 2:Samsung One UI 9 音乐播放器动画(512 likes)
- 内容描述:@theonecid 分享 Samsung One UI 9 音乐播放器的专辑封面动画效果
- 互动证据:512 likes — 高互动,说明用户对音乐播放器视觉效果有审美偏好
- 用户原话:
"Samsung One UI 9 music player now has beautiful album art animations. This is what a modern music player should look like." — @theonecid (512 likes) 中文:三星 One UI 9 音乐播放器现在有了美丽的专辑封面动画。这才是现代音乐播放器该有的样子。
- 与假设的关系:用户确实喜欢音乐播放器有好的视觉效果,但这是手机 OS 层面的体验升级,由 Samsung/Apple 等 OEM 厂商提供。第三方 app 很难在这个层面竞争。
内容 3:Three.js 3D 音乐可视化器展示项目(82 likes)
- 内容描述:@techartist_ 用 Three.js + React Three Fiber 制作的 3D 音乐可视化器
- 互动证据:82 likes, 9,247 views — 开发者社区有一定关注
- 用户原话:
"Built a 3D music visualizer using Three.js. Vibe-coded the whole thing. Web Audio API + React Three Fiber." — @techartist_ (82 likes, 9,247 views) 中文:用 Three.js 做了一个 3D 音乐可视化器。整个项目都是 vibe-coded 的。用了 Web Audio API + React Three Fiber。
- 与假设的关系:Three.js 音乐可视化器是开发者社区的创意展示项目,不是用户在寻找的产品。互动主要来自其他开发者说"cool",不是用户说"我需要这个"。
内容 4:Audius 平台内置可视化器(17 likes)
- 内容描述:去中心化音乐平台 Audius 内置了 3D 音频响应可视化功能
- 互动证据:17 likes — 低互动
- 与假设的关系:说明平台方在尝试集成可视化功能,但用户反应平淡
内容 5:日本开发者自制音频可视化器(8 likes)
- 内容描述:@masa_manga 因为"没有找到完全合适的"而自制了开源音频可视化器
- 互动证据:8 likes — 极低互动
- 用户原话:
"Made an audio visualizer because there wasn't one that was just right." — @masa_manga (8 likes) 中文:做了一个音频可视化器,因为没有一个是完全合适的。
- 与假设的关系:开发者自嗨项目,非终端用户需求
竞品/替代品反馈
- OS 级音乐播放器:Samsung One UI 9、Apple Music、Spotify 已经在持续改进歌词展示效果。Spotify 的歌词功能主要是同步显示+翻译,用户讨论的焦点是"歌词准确性"和"歌词翻译质量",不是"歌词不够炫酷"
- Three.js/WebGL 可视化器:社区活跃但完全是开发者艺术项目(creative coding),没有商业化迹象
- AI 音乐视频生成(参考同步调研):OpenArt+Lyria 3 (934 likes)、VibeMe (104 likes) 正在让"炫酷歌词效果"变得可以被 AI 一键生成,进一步降低了对独立歌词效果工具的需求
- 歌词动画工具:@mollowmollow 的 Easy Lyric Motion System (801 likes) 已经覆盖了内容创作者对歌词动画的需求
2. 受众画像
- 假设的目标用户:日常听歌的用户,希望音乐播放器有更炫酷的歌词展示效果
- 实际发现的用户:
- Three.js/WebGL 开发者:将音乐可视化作为技术展示项目(@techartist_, @masa_manga)
- VJ / 现场演出视觉设计师:需要歌词动画工具,但面向舞台/视频制作,不是个人听歌场景(@mollowmollow)
- 普通音乐听众:对音乐播放器的期望是"播放音乐 + 显示歌词",没有"歌词需要 3D 效果"的需求
- 聚集地:
- Reddit: r/webgl, r/threejs, r/MusicVisualizers — 开发者社区
- Twitter: #creativecoding, #webgl, #threejs — 创意编码社区
- 没有发现普通用户在讨论"音乐播放器歌词效果"的社区
- 付费信号:零。没有任何一条帖子、推文、评论提到愿意为音乐播放器的歌词视觉效果付费。
3. 变现分析 (B2B vs B2C 权重评估)
- 属性判定:B2C 个人消费体验。如果存在的话,这将是面向个人音乐听众的增强体验功能。
- 付费意愿指数 (0/10分):
- 加分项:无
- 减分项:
- 12 轮搜索中零付费意愿信号 — 没有任何人提到愿意为音乐播放器视觉效果付费
- 音乐播放器是"工具型"产品,用户的核心需求是"听歌",不是"看歌词效果"
- Spotify/Apple Music 等主流平台已经提供歌词功能,且免费
- Samsung/Apple 等 OEM 厂商在 OS 层面提供音乐播放器视觉效果(One UI 9, iOS animated album art),第三方 app 无法在这一层竞争
- B2C 用户对"锦上添花"型功能(非核心功能)的付费意愿极低
- 即使是开发者社区,Three.js 音乐可视化器也是免费开源的
- 定价参考:
- 主流音乐播放器:免费(Spotify 免费版、Apple Music 订阅制含歌词)
- 音乐可视化器 app:多为免费或极低价
- 不存在"音乐播放器歌词效果"的付费市场
- 收入参考:无。不存在同类付费产品。
- 变现路径建议:此方向无法变现。
4. 假设验证总结
| 假设 | 验证结果 | 证据 |
|---|---|---|
| 假设A:用户对现有音乐播放器的歌词展示效果不满意 | 否定 | 12 轮搜索中没有任何用户抱怨歌词展示效果。用户对歌词的讨论集中在"准确性"和"翻译",不是"视觉效果"。 |
| 假设B:Three.js/WebGL 3D 歌词效果是用户想要的 | 否定 | Three.js 音乐可视化器是开发者创意项目(82 likes),不是用户需求。最强的歌词动画工具(801 likes)面向 VJ/内容创作者,不是音乐播放器用户。 |
| 假设C:用户愿意为此付费 | 否定 | 零付费意愿信号。音乐播放器的核心功能是"听歌",歌词效果是"锦上添花"。OEM 厂商免费提供视觉效果进一步压低了付费预期。 |
5. MVP 建议(聚焦 PMF 验证)
不建议开发此产品。 原因:
- 没有痛点:用户没有表达过"音乐播放器歌词效果不够好"的愿望
- 方向错位:Three.js 音乐可视化器是开发者创意项目,歌词动画工具是 VJ/内容创作工具,两者都不是"音乐播放器"赛道
- 无法变现:零付费意愿信号,主流平台免费提供歌词功能
如果你对 Three.js + 音乐可视化有兴趣,更好的方向:
- 方向 A:VJ/现场演出歌词动画工具(对标 @mollowmollow 的 801 likes)— 面向内容创作者,有明确的创作需求
- 方向 B:歌词视频一键生成工具(参考同步调研的歌词视频报告)— 面向 AI 音乐创作者(Suno 用户),有痛点但市场小
- 方向 C:Three.js 创意编码模板/课程 — 面向想学 Three.js 的开发者,卖教程/模板,但这是完全不同的商业模式
6. 极简技术架构(仅供参考,不推荐实施)
- 产品形态:Web App(浏览器端音乐播放器 + Three.js 歌词效果)
- 技术栈(如果一定要做):
- 前端:React + Three.js / React Three Fiber + Web Audio API
- 歌词同步:LRC 格式解析 + Web Audio API 时间轴同步
- 3D 效果:Three.js 粒子系统 / Shader 材质 / 文字几何体
- 音频分析:Web Audio API AnalyserNode(频谱/节拍检测)
- 部署:Vercel 或 Cloudflare Pages
- "绝对不要用"的护栏:
- 不要做音乐库管理 — 用户已经有 Spotify/Apple Music
- 不要做桌面端 app — Web 端即可
- 不要做复杂的音频分析 AI — 用简单的 LRC 同步就够了
- 最快跑通闭环的第一步:用 React Three Fiber 写一个组件,加载一首歌的音频 + LRC 歌词文件,在 Three.js 场景中渲染 3D 歌词文字,根据音频频谱数据驱动文字动画
7. 冷启动策略
不适用 — 没有找到目标用户群体。
如果要做上述"更好的方向"(VJ 歌词动画工具):
- 前 10 个用户:去 Twitter 搜索 "lyric video" 或 "VJ lyrics",找到内容创作者,私信推荐工具
- 内容营销:在 #creativecoding 和 #VJ 标签下展示 Three.js 歌词效果 demo
- 不可以说:不要对普通音乐听众营销"炫酷歌词效果" — 他们不需要
8. 烟雾测试素材 (Smoke Test Assets)
注意:由于此方向的三个假设全部被否定,以下烟雾测试素材不建议使用。
Reddit 潜入式回帖(2 条)
回帖 1 — 适用于 r/webgl 或 r/threejs 技术展示帖
我最近在做一个 Web 端的音乐播放器,用 Three.js 做歌词的 3D 动态效果——粒子文字 + 音频频谱驱动。目前是个周末项目,效果还挺酷的。如果有人想看 demo 或者贡献代码,可以 DM 我。
回帖 2 — 适用于 r/MusicVisualizers 或类似社区
我用 React Three Fiber + Web Audio API 做了一个浏览器端的 3D 歌词可视化器。支持 LRC 歌词文件导入,文字会跟着节拍动。目前还是 demo 阶段,有兴趣的可以试试。
X (Twitter) Build-in-Public 预热推文(2 条)
推文 A(技术展示法)
周末用 Three.js + Web Audio API 搓了一个 3D 歌词可视化器。歌词文字会跟着音频频谱实时变化,粒子效果随节拍脉动。
纯前端,浏览器直接打开就能用。代码开源在 GitHub。
#threejs #webgl #creativecoding
推文 B(技术探索法)
好奇:大家听歌的时候,会在意歌词的展示效果吗?比如 3D 动画、粒子效果之类的?
我在做一个实验性的 Web 音乐播放器,想看看 Three.js 歌词效果是否有人感兴趣。
8. 风险与判断
最大风险:
- 这是一个"解决方案在找问题"的典型例子(致命风险):技术很酷(Three.js + 音乐可视化),但没有用户在寻找这个解决方案。12 轮搜索,零痛点信号。
- 音乐播放器市场已被巨头垄断:Spotify、Apple Music、YouTube Music 占据了绝大多数用户。第三方音乐播放器几乎没有生存空间。
- OEM 厂商在 OS 层面提供视觉效果:Samsung One UI 9 (512 likes) 的音乐播放器动画说明,手机厂商正在原生集成这些体验。第三方 app 无法竞争。
- AI 视频生成正在让"歌词效果"过时:同步调研显示,OpenArt+Lyria 3 (934 likes)、VibeMe (104 likes) 等 AI 工具可以一键生成完整音乐视频,单独的歌词效果工具价值在下降。
Go / No-Go 建议:强烈 No-Go
- 理由:
- 三个核心假设全部被否定:用户没有对现有歌词效果不满(假设A 否定),Three.js 3D 效果不是用户需求(假设B 否定),零付费意愿(假设C 否定)
- 12 轮搜索,零痛点信号:这是所有调研中信号最弱的方向之一。连弱信号都没有。
- "技术驱动"而非"需求驱动":这个想法的出发点是"Three.js 很酷,可以用来做音乐播放器",而不是"用户有一个未满足的需求"。这是创业中最常见的失败模式。
- 没有任何可参考的付费市场:不存在同类付费产品,不存在定价参考,不存在收入参考
- 理由:
如果你想用 Three.js 做产品,更好的方向:
- VJ/现场演出歌词动画工具(@mollowmollow 的 801 likes, 858 bookmarks 证明有需求)— 但这是内容创作工具,不是音乐播放器
- 3D 产品展示/配置器(B2B SaaS,付费意愿高)
- Three.js 创意编码教程/模板市场(卖知识/模板,不是卖产品)